W825 RPD is a 2000 Peugeot Elyseo in Blue with a 125c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2000 Peugeot Elyseo models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.5% with a typical mileage of 14,452 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Peugeot Elyseo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 321 recorded failures. If you're considering buying W825 RPD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ot Elyseo typ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 26 years old, this Peugeot Elyseo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
